    I went to crst to get my Cdl signed the contract. This was back in Jan 14 now I didn't not complete the 8 months losty license. Now almost 3 years later they claim I'm still under contract. The non compete clause states 8 months of employment or reimbursement. To be released the goes to define the restrictive term. Which reads. Any amount of time remaining of the "term" after termination of crst's employment of employee with or without cause by either party. To me seems like the contract was voided in Oct 14. Why in the world are they claiming I'm under contract.
